Comprehensive Overview to Software Application Engineering Meetings
Exactly how to Get Ready For Software Application Engineer Meetings Properly
Software Application Engineer Interview Prep Training C thumbnail

Comprehensive Overview to Software Application Engineering Meetings Exactly how to Get Ready For Software Application Engineer Meetings Properly Software Application Engineer Interview Prep Training C

Published Feb 01, 25
7 min read

What are common challenges in Google Software Engineer Interview Prep?

The crucial concepts to be covered while prepping for coding interviews include arrays, strings, recursion, hash tables, trees, charts, vibrant shows, and arranging formulas. To aid you toenail coding interviews at the most significant firms, Interview Kickstart offers 13 coding meeting prep work training courses.

Throughout this time, you can schedule mock meetings, 1-on-1 advisor sessions with market professionals, and therapy sessions with our extremely experienced career instructors. Interview Kickstart's group of extremely certified instructors are current hiring managers and participants of the hiring committee at FAANG+ firms. Our instructors are carefully associated with the interview procedure at leading firms, offering our students an enormous side over the competition.

I 'd like to present myself as the newest member of the Impact Interview group. I've been prompted to offer some experienced advice to those of you facing the prospect of undergoing a technical interview. I have actually been in the software program field for the last 7 years and am currently an engineering manager at More significantly, nonetheless, throughout my career I've been constantly interested in technological interviews and have had a broad selection of experience resting on both sides of the table.



The bulk of prospects I interview end up not receiving job deals since they mess up some technical portion of the interview. Most of these cases, nevertheless, it has nothing to do with the knowledge or ability of the prospects, however instead their lack of ideal prep work for a technical meeting.

This question typically verifies to be a stumper, but if correct issue fixing methods are utilized it comes to be a lot more workable absolutely not easy, but convenient. Off, you need to recognize that the 1MB need is just a made up number. For troubles similar to this that have large data collections, it's alluring to start by taking a look at the large picture, but that's not truly the way you intend to fix them.

What skills are essential for Software Engineer Role-specific Interview Tips preparation?

If you've processed one integer and after that are asked to return a number at arbitrary, what do you require to do? Well, that's easy, you need to return the one number that you have actually seen with 100% chance.

For every number that you check out from the stream you'll need to roll an N sided pass away to choose whether that becomes your brand-new return number or otherwise, if it is after that you can neglect whatever the old return number was and store the new one in its place. For the initial number you see you'll have a 1/1 probability of making that your return number.

What is the role of algorithms in Mock Interviews For Software Developers preparation?
What skills are essential for Mock Coding Tests For Software Roles preparation?


I'll leave it as an exercise to the viewers to compose out the inductive evidence to reveal that this actually works, however that's the response. Note that this isn't an especially good interview concern as it calls for some specific probability knowledge to address. However I've seen it asked previously, and it aids illustrate that having a good technique to issue resolving can mean the difference in between going to pieces on a question and at least clearing up progression.

How do I approach behavioral questions during Mock Coding Tests For Software Roles?

The trick is out: great deals of task candidates are doing meeting mentoring to obtain an advantage. If you've obtained a meeting showing up, you're most likely asking on your own: what is a meeting instructor, and should I hire one? It's tricky since there are dozens of interview training solutions available, with significant variants in rates that sometimes birth little relationship to the high quality of the mentoring.

We've also classified them for various demands and specialties. Interview training is where you function with an expert instructor to boost your chances of thrilling in a work interview and landing a task deal.

If they have actually operated in your sector, they can give you particular insights into what your recruiters will certainly be seeking. The most typical layout for the mentoring session is a mock interview. Your train will play the role of the interviewer and ask you the kind of concerns that you're preparing for.

After conducting a mock meeting with you, your train ought to be able to zoom in on your weaker areas and give you extremely workable, certain comments that you can eliminate and utilize to enhance your efficiency. Some candidates like to use meeting mentoring to test their readiness levels. They then adjust their interview prep work appropriately.

In this way, you can either enter into your meeting loaded with self-confidence or take the required actions to enhance while you have actually left. As opposed to scheduling a session with an interview instructor as a "dress rehearsal" for the actual point, you may pick to make use of a trainer previously on in your prep work process.

How does Facebook Coding Interview compare to technical interviews in other fields?

Apparently, 93% of individuals feel nervous before a task meeting. Unless you're one of the 7% with ice in their capillaries, you'll require to locate a method to handle nerves, continue to be tranquil, and job self-confidence. The even more you exercise something, the less difficult it must become, so mock meetings with an instructor can actually help in reducing anxiety.

What are the top tools for practicing Advanced Coding Challenges For Interviews?
What are the top strategies for acing Google Interview Preparation?


Frequently, interview procedures at huge firms are sluggish and instead opaque and is valuable however has its limitations. If you actually desire some insight from somebody who's gotten on the within of the procedure, book a meeting train that has actually run interviews at the company you're speaking with for.

You can utilize common structures to structure your responses. A lot of individuals utilize the Celebrity method for answering behavior concerns (though we think that the SPSIL approach is better). A meeting trainer can show you the appropriate solution structures that relate to your interviews. Showing great communication skills is vital to acing a meeting.

What real-world scenarios are tested in Google Interview Preparation?
How do I approach behavioral questions during How To Build Confidence For Coding Interviews?


They need to likewise have the ability to provide you ideas on your non-verbal interaction. Functioning with an interview train can help you ace the meeting and put yourself right into a more powerful negotiating position than you would have accomplished or else. Some interview trainers also provide return to testimonial solutions, where rather than running a simulated meeting they'll put in the time to undergo your resume and identify areas for improvement.

At the leading end, exec mentoring bundles start at around $500 and run into the thousands. Different factors affect what you may pay for meeting mentoring: The kind of experience the trainers have actually and exactly how specialized they are Just how excellent the internet site is (e.g.

How do I tackle coding challenges in Algorithms And Data Structures For Interviews?
What skills are essential for Advanced Software Engineer Interview Techniques preparation?


The key is to make sure you're obtaining worth for money.

The short response is: yes, possibly. Allow's take a look at exactly when it is worth the financial investment, and when it's possibly best to pass. Thousands of candidates apply for each open placement, and you can do rather well in your interviews and still not make the cut.

If you're wishing to get a task at a top firm, you'll possibly have to go with a number of meetings. And you will not be able to depend on a smile and a solid return to - you'll require to provide great response to challenging concerns, time and again. In this context, anything you can do to improve your meeting skills and approach the interviews with self-confidence makes a whole lot of sense.

From a simply financial point of view, why wouldn't you invest a couple of hundred dollars on meeting training to increase your opportunities? Practically everybody gets at the very least a bit anxious prior to task meetings, however some individuals obtain so stressed that they can not offer an excellent account of themselves.